Garage Flooring Options Compared

Six ways to cover a garage slab, and the choice is decided less by looks or budget than by two things about your concrete: whether it is dry, and whether it is sound.

Every garage flooring guide starts with looks and budget. Start instead with the slab, because a damp or cracked floor rules out half the options immediately and no amount of budget changes that.

1. The Six Options at a Glance

These are genuinely different categories, not price tiers of the same thing. Two bond to the slab, two sit on it, one soaks into it, and one is doing nothing at all.

Option Bonds to Slab? Typical Life DIY Friendly?
Epoxy coating Yes 10-20 yrs at 100% solids Possible, unforgiving
Polyaspartic / polyurea Yes 15-20 yrs Usually professional
Floor paint Yes 1-3 yrs Yes, easiest
Interlocking tiles No 10-20 yrs Yes, an afternoon
Roll-out matting No 5-15 yrs Yes, the easiest of all
Penetrating sealer Soaks in 5-10 yrs Yes

The bonding column is the one to read first. Anything that bonds needs a slab that is dry and sound, because a coating can only be as good as what it is stuck to. Anything that does not bond can go over concrete that would defeat a coating entirely, which is why tiles and matting are the answer to problems rather than merely a style choice.

Start Here, Not With a Catalogue

Tape plastic sheeting to the bare slab for 48 hours.

If there is condensation on the underside when you lift it, vapour is driving up through the concrete, and every bonded coating on this list will eventually be pushed off by it. That one test, costing nothing, narrows six options to three before you have looked at a single product. It is the step almost nobody takes and the one that explains most failed garage floors.

2. The Bonded Coatings

These form a film chemically attached to the concrete. Done properly on the right slab, they give the hard, glossy, easy-to-sweep floor most people are picturing.

Epoxy

The default and the best value when it suits. A 100% solids product on a ground, dry slab is a ten to twenty year floor. The catch is that solids content varies enormously under the same word: water-based products at around 45 percent solids cure to a thin film worth one to three years. Application is unforgiving too, with pot life often as short as thirty minutes.

Polyaspartic and Polyurea

Faster curing, genuinely UV stable, and tolerant of a wider temperature range, which is why professional one-day installations use them. They handle a cold garage in winter that epoxy would refuse to cure in. The trade is cost and an even shorter working window, which makes them a poor first DIY attempt.

Floor Paint

Honest about what it is: a coating that looks good for a season or two and needs redoing. It is cheap, forgiving, and genuinely reasonable for a rental, a quick sale, or a garage you do not use hard. The disappointment comes from products marketed with the word epoxy that are essentially latex paint with a small epoxy content, which is a different thing from two-part epoxy entirely.

3. The Options That Do Not Bond

Underrated, and frequently the right answer. Because nothing is chemically attached, nothing can delaminate, and the slab underneath is free to breathe.

Interlocking Tiles Roll-Out Matting
Installation An afternoon, no prep Under an hour, no prep
Hides cracks and stains Yes Yes
Works on a damp slab Yes Yes
Damaged section repair Replace single tiles Replace the roll
Removable Fully, and reusable Fully, and reusable
Underfoot feel Rigid, slight seams Softer, seamless
Water handling Some drain, some trap Contains spills well

The case for these is strongest in three situations: a slab that failed the moisture test, a cracked or stained floor you do not want to repair, and a rented property where a permanent coating is not yours to install. In all three they solve the problem that a coating cannot solve at any price.

4. Sealer and Bare Concrete

The two options nobody puts in a brochure, and both are legitimate answers rather than a failure to decide.

A penetrating sealer soaks into the slab rather than forming a film on top. It cannot peel because there is nothing to peel, it does not trap vapour, and it reduces dusting and makes spills easier to clean. What it will not do is give you gloss, colour or a showroom look. For a working garage where the floor is a floor rather than a feature, it is quietly the most sensible option on this list.

  • It works where coatings fail, including slabs with some moisture drive.
  • It costs the least of any option that does anything at all.
  • Reapplication is straightforward and does not require stripping the previous treatment.
  • It leaves the concrete looking like concrete, slightly darkened at most.
  • It reduces the concrete dust that bare slabs shed onto everything stored in a garage.
  • It does nothing to hide cracks, stains or a poor finish.

Bare concrete is the remaining option, and its real cost is dust and stains rather than appearance. Untreated slabs shed fine dust continuously, oil soaks straight in, and de-icing salt tracked off a car attacks the surface over years. If you do nothing else, a sealer addresses all three cheaply. 5. Choosing by Your Actual Situation

Work down this list and stop at the first row that describes your garage. It sorts more cleanly than any feature comparison.

Your Situation Best Option
Slab fails the moisture test Tiles or roll-out matting
Slab is cracked or stained but sound Tiles, or repair then coat
Slab is spalling or structurally poor Repair first; no covering fixes it
Dry sound slab, want it to last 100% solids epoxy, or polyaspartic
Dry slab, cold garage, winter install Polyaspartic or polyurea
Renting, or selling soon Matting, tiles, or paint
Working garage, function over looks Penetrating sealer
Want it done in one day by a pro Polyaspartic

Notice that the top three rows are about the concrete rather than the covering. That ordering is deliberate: no product on this list repairs a slab, and several of them will fail on one that needed repair first. Spalling and structural cracking are a concrete job, and covering them simply postpones and hides the problem.

6. What Preparation Each Option Needs

This is where the real difference in effort sits, and it is invisible in a price comparison.

Option Preparation Required Realistic Time
Epoxy Grind, degrease, repair, prime A weekend plus cure time
Polyaspartic Grind, degrease, repair Often one day, professionally
Floor paint Clean, etch or grind A day plus cure
Interlocking tiles Sweep An afternoon
Roll-out matting Sweep Under an hour
Penetrating sealer Clean thoroughly A few hours

For anything bonded, grinding is the reliable preparation and acid etching is the one that fails invisibly. Etching works on bare, porous, untreated concrete and does very little on a hard-troweled, previously sealed or oil-contaminated slab, with no obvious sign of failure until the coating lifts months later. 7. Why Most Garage Floors Fail

The failure patterns are consistent enough to be diagnostic, and each points at a decision made before the covering went down.

  • Sheets lifting cleanly with bare concrete underneath means moisture drove up through the slab.
  • Peeling starting at edges or wheel tracks means preparation left the surface too smooth to grip.
  • Coating pulling up with warm tyres means a film too thin or not fully cured before use.
  • Cracks reappearing through a new coating means the slab moved and the covering could not bridge it.
  • A floor that looked good for one season means a low-solids product sold under a premium-sounding name.
  • Patchy dull areas mean contamination, usually oil, that was never fully removed.

Almost none of those are product defects. They are the slab and the preparation showing through, which is why the moisture test and the grinding decision matter more than which brand you buy. Our guide to epoxy flooring goes into the chemistry behind the two most common failures.

The practical implication is where to spend. Given a fixed budget, money moved from a premium product to proper preparation buys more floor life than the reverse, and a mid-range coating on a ground, dry, repaired slab will outlast a premium one on an unprepared floor every time.

8. Common Mistakes to Avoid

Choosing the Covering Before Testing the Slab

A bonded coating can only be as good as what it is stuck to, and concrete on grade often pushes vapour upward that will lift any film. Tape plastic sheeting down for 48 hours and look for condensation underneath. That free test rules options in or out before you look at a single product.

Covering a Slab That Needs Repair

Spalling, structural cracking and a crumbling surface are concrete problems, and nothing on this list fixes them. A coating over a failing slab fails with it, and tiles hide the problem while it continues underneath. Repair first, then choose a covering.

Buying a Product Because It Says Epoxy

The word covers two-part 100% solids systems worth ten to twenty years and latex paints with a small epoxy content worth one or two. Solids content is the specification that separates them, and it is rarely on the front of the tin. Check it before comparing prices.

Acid Etching Instead of Grinding

Etching only works on bare, porous, untreated concrete, and it does very little on hard-troweled, previously sealed or oily slabs. You get no indication it has failed until the coating peels months later. Grinding removes the uncertainty for the price of a day's rental.

Dismissing Tiles and Matting as a Compromise

They are the correct answer for a damp slab, a cracked one you do not want to repair, and a rental. Because nothing bonds, nothing delaminates, and the concrete breathes underneath. They also go down in an afternoon with no preparation, and they lift out again if you move.

9. Frequently Asked Questions

What is the best garage flooring option?

It depends on the slab rather than the budget. On dry, sound concrete, 100% solids epoxy or polyaspartic gives the longest life. On a slab that fails a moisture test or is cracked and unrepaired, interlocking tiles or roll-out matting are better, because nothing bonds so nothing can lift.

What is the cheapest way to cover a garage floor?

Floor paint or roll-out matting for the lowest cost today, and a penetrating sealer for the lowest cost per year if looks are not the point. Compare per year of service, since paint redone every second year costs more than a coating that lasts a decade, plus a weekend each time.

Are garage floor tiles better than epoxy?

On a damp or cracked slab, yes, decisively. Tiles do not bond, so vapour cannot push them off and cracks do not telegraph through. On dry, sound concrete epoxy gives a harder, seamless surface that is easier to sweep, and it usually looks better.

Can I put flooring over a cracked garage floor?

Tiles and matting cover cracks immediately and cosmetically. Coatings do not: the slab still moves and the crack reappears through the film. If the cracking is structural or the surface is spalling, that is a concrete repair, and covering it postpones the problem rather than solving it.

How do I know if my garage slab is too damp to coat?

Tape an 18 inch square of plastic sheeting tightly to the bare concrete for 24 to 48 hours, then lift it. Condensation underneath or a dark patch on the slab means vapour is coming through. Test several spots, especially near walls and corners.

What lasts longest on a garage floor?

A 100% solids epoxy or a polyaspartic system on a ground, dry slab, both in the ten to twenty year range. Interlocking tiles last comparably long and can be replaced individually when damaged, which is an advantage epoxy does not have.

Do I need to grind my garage floor before coating it?

For any bonded coating it is the reliable preparation. Coatings grip mechanically into surface texture, so a smooth, sealed or contaminated slab gives them nothing to hold. Tiles, matting and sealers need far less: sweeping or a thorough clean.

What can I do with a garage floor in winter?

Tiles and matting go down at any temperature. Among coatings, polyaspartic and polyurea tolerate a much wider temperature range than epoxy, which may simply refuse to cure properly in a cold garage. Check the minimum application temperature before buying anything bonded.

The Bottom Line

Six real options: epoxy, polyaspartic, paint, interlocking tiles, roll-out matting and penetrating sealer. They split into things that bond to the slab and things that do not, and that division decides more than price or appearance does.

So start with the concrete. Tape plastic sheeting to the bare slab for 48 hours, and if there is condensation underneath, every bonded coating is eventually going to be pushed off. Check for spalling and structural cracking too, because no covering repairs a slab and several will fail on one that needed repair first.

On dry, sound concrete, 100% solids epoxy is the best value and polyaspartic buys UV stability and a one-day install. On a damp or cracked slab, tiles and matting stop being a compromise and start being the only thing that works. And on a working garage where the floor is a floor, a penetrating sealer quietly does the useful part for the least money.
